Market context

Benjamin Netanyahu is still in office, but the path to him being out by the end of 2026 runs mainly through Israel’s election cycle and coalition arithmetic, not a voluntary resignation. Reuters reported in June that he had confirmed he would run again, while also noting that polls pointed to a likely loss for his right-wing bloc and that he could still try to piece together a new coalition if the election produces a fragmented Knesset.[2]

The market’s 0% implied probability looks extreme when set against Israel’s recent pattern of leaders surviving crisis, but not impossible. Netanyahu has repeatedly outlasted political setbacks over decades in power, and current polling still leaves Likud competitive even as public frustration over the war, corruption proceedings, and governance failures remains high.[3][5] Comparable cases in Israeli politics suggest that a sitting prime minister can remain in post through an election defeat if coalition talks drag on, which matters because “out” here includes resignation, removal, or stepping aside before 31 December 2026.[2][8]

The key catalysts are the election timetable, coalition stability, and any official announcement from Netanyahu or the president after the vote. Israel must hold an election by October 2026, and coalition strains around ultra-Orthodox draft exemptions, budgets, and war management could still force an early collapse or a leadership shift before then.[5][8] Traders should also watch for coalition partner defections, legal developments in his corruption cases, and any formal statement that he will not continue as prime minister after the election; even a pre-election retirement signal would resolve the market to Yes.[2][9]
